Common Services Offered by Mesquite Green Card Attorneys

Green Card lawyers in Mesquite typically assist with a wide range of immigration matters. Their services are designed to address the diverse reasons individuals seek permanent residency. Some of the most common areas they handle include:

  • Family-Based Green Cards: Assisting U.S. citizens and lawful permanent residents in sponsoring their relatives from abroad, such as spouses, parents, children, and siblings.
  • Employment-Based Green Cards: Guiding individuals through the process of obtaining a Green Card based on job offers from U.S. employers, which often involves complex labor certification steps.
  • Diversity Visa Program: Helping eligible individuals from countries with historically low rates of immigration to the United States apply for the annual Diversity Visa Lottery.
  • Asylum and Refugee Status: Representing individuals who are fleeing persecution in their home countries and seeking protection in the United States.
  • Marriage to a U.S. Citizen: A common route for many in the Mesquite community, this involves demonstrating the bona fides of the marriage to USCIS.
  • Adjustment of Status: Assisting individuals already present in the U.S. who are eligible to apply for a Green Card without having to leave the country.

These attorneys are well-versed in the forms and documentation required by USCIS, including those submitted to the Dallas USCIS field office, which serves residents of Mesquite. They can also represent clients in immigration court proceedings if necessary, though the primary focus for Green Card applications is usually with USCIS.

The Steps Involved in a Typical Green Card Application

While each case is unique, the general process for obtaining a Green Card involves several key stages. A Mesquite Green Card lawyer will guide you through each step meticulously:

  • Eligibility Assessment: The attorney will first determine which Green Card category you qualify for based on your family ties, employment, or other criteria.
  • Petition Filing: Depending on the category, a petition will be filed with USCIS. This could be an I-130 Petition for Alien Relative for family-based cases or an I-140 Immigrant Petition for Alien Worker for employment-based cases.
  • Visa Availability: For many categories, there may be a waiting period until a visa number becomes available, as determined by the U.S. Department of State’s Visa Bulletin.
  • Application Submission: Once a visa number is available, you will either apply for Adjustment of Status (if in the U.S.) or consular processing (if abroad). This involves submitting the I-485 Application to Register Permanent Residence or Adjust Status or the DS-260 Immigrant Visa Application, respectively.
  • Biometrics Appointment: You will likely be required to attend a biometrics appointment at a USCIS Application Support Center to provide fingerprints, photograph, and signature.
  • Interview: Many applicants are required to attend an interview at a USCIS office to verify information and ensure eligibility.
  • Decision: USCIS will then make a decision on your application.

Your attorney will ensure all necessary supporting documents, such as birth certificates, marriage certificates, financial evidence, and police clearances, are gathered and submitted correctly. What if I have a criminal record? Can I still get a Green Card in Mesquite?

Having a criminal record can complicate your Green Card application. Certain offenses can make you inadmissible to the United States. However, immigration law is complex, and there may be waivers or exceptions available depending on the nature of the offense and other factors. A Mesquite Green Card lawyer can assess your specific criminal history and advise you on your eligibility and potential options.

How Green Card Lawyer Works

The specific path (family, employment, asylum, diversity) determines the petition form and evidence package; after petition approval, adjustment of status (I-485) or consular processing follows; biometrics, medical exam (I-693), and an interview are typically required; a conditional green card (2-year) is issued for recent marriages and requires removal of conditions (I-751) before the 2-year expiration

How long does Green Card Lawyer take?

Green card processing (I-485 adjustment of status) currently takes 12–36 months from filing depending on the applicant's country of birth and preference category. Employment-based applicants from high-demand countries face significantly longer waits due to per-country caps.

When evaluating an immigration attorney, confirm they are licensed to practice law in Texas (or in any U.S. state, as immigration law is federal), and verify they are a member of the American Immigration Lawyers Association (AILA). Avoid notarios and non-attorney consultants who illegally practice immigration law — this is a significant problem in many communities and the errors they make can bar people from future immigration benefits.

Immigration in Dallas County — What the Census Data Shows

The U.S. Census Bureau estimates 641,680 foreign-born residents in Dallas County — 24.6% of the population, well above the national county median of 2.7%. In counties with an established immigrant population this size, family-based and employment-based adjustment cases are common enough that local firms typically handle them routinely rather than as an occasional matter. Source: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ey 5-Year Estimates 2022 (table B05002). This page is general information, not legal advice.
